Filter 2 Building Alterations

2 Filters Selected
Building Alterations x
Malta x
Mellieha x

2 Building Alterations Found

1

MV Works Ltd

Mellieha, Malta | Building Alterations
2

T & T Builders Ltd

Mellieha, Malta | Building Alterations